当前位置:首页 > 手机资讯 > 正文

开发板通过主机http代理服务器上网方法

开发板通过主机http代理服务器上网方法

在Arduino的环境下,如果ESP32-C3开发板通过MQTT X代理服务器连接不到MQTT服务器,可能是以下原因导致的: 1. ESP32-C3开发板无法连接到MQTT X代理服务器:请确保ESP32-C3开发板可以连接到MQTT X代理服务器。您可以在Arduino代码中使用WiFiClient连接到MQTT X代理服务器,然后再使用PubSubClient连接到MQTT服务器。如果ESP32-C3开发板无法连接到MQTT X代理服务器,请检查您的网络设置和代理服务器的设置。 2. 代理服务器设置错误:请确保MQTT X代理服务器的地址和端口号是正确的。您可以在MQTT X代理服务器的控制台中查看代理服务器的详细信息,并将其配置到Arduino代码中。 3. MQTT服务器设置错误:请确保MQTT服务器的地址和端口号是正确的。您可以在MQTT服务器的控制台中查看MQTT服务器的详细信息,并将其配置到Arduino代码中。 4. 安全设置错误:如果MQTT服务器启用了安全设置(例如TLS/SSL),您需要在Arduino代码中配置相应的安全选项。具体的配置方式可以参考PubSubClient库的说明文档。 5. 代码错误:如果以上步骤都正确配置了,但ESP32-C3开发板仍然无法连接到MQTT服务器,请检查您的Arduino代码是否正确。您可以尝试使用其他的MQTT库或示例代码来测试连接。如果问题仍然存在,请尝试在Arduino代码中添加调试信息,以便更好地定位问题。

最新文章